Description
The Queen's Gambit meets The Hunger Games in this ';brisk and brutalharrowing and intriguing' (Kirkus Reviews) novel about a teen girl whose abusive father teaches her the finer points of chess and hunting, all for his own sinister endsdrawn from the author's own experiences.
For forever, Didi has had to be the best at anything her father demanded of herthe fastest runner, the master at chess, able to take down a deer with a bow and arrow at a dead sprint. If she fails, he denies her food. Clothes. Kindness. Yet he claims he loves herhe says he doesit's why he pushes her. To be ready. Prepared. For anything. Ready to fight. Ready to
Didi is terrified of what he may one day ask.
But she might be more prepared than her father ever expected.
